Abstract :
A novel chemiluminescent method using flow injection has been investigated for the rapid and sensitive determination of flufenamic and mefenamic acids. The method is based on a tris(2,2′-bipyridyl)ruthenium(III) chemiluminescence reaction. Ru(bipy)33+ is chemically generated by mixing two streams containing solutions of tris(2,2′-bipyridyl)ruthenium(II) and acidic cerium(IV) sulphate. After selecting the best operating parameters calibration graphs were obtained over the concentration ranges 0.07–6.0 and 0.05–6.0 μg ml−1 for flufenamic acid and mefenamic acid, respectively. The limits of detection (s/n=3) were 3.6×10−9 M flufenamic acid and 2.1×10−7 M mefenamic acid. The method was successfully applied to the determination of these compounds in pharmaceutical formulations and biological fluids. A proposal for the reaction pathway was given.
